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
74132 698648 1422103
3814292 04495989 51714
3814292 04495989 51714
3066919 0414375999 06
All about undefined
Interested in learning more?
3814292 04495989 51714
3066919 0414375999 06
See more
858985 88238755
259245371 5369 2688491 29993289
See more
42941558 01394 3335068345
3262 456 41
See more